Civil Procedure Code, 1908, Order 8, Rule 10 -- Written statement - Non-filing - O.8.R.10 CPC does not mandate Court to decree suit for no, filing of written statement, but gives it discretion either to pronounce judgment against defendant or to make such order in relation to suit as it thinks fit...........

Criminal Procedure Code, 1973, Section 397, 311 -- Revision - Maintainability - Order rejecting application u/s 311 Cr.P.C is an interlocutory order and no revision against said order is maintainable - Revision rightly dismissed...........

Criminal Procedure Code, 1973, Section 156(3) -- Direction for registration of FIR - Once Magistrate takes cognizance of offence, he cannot thereafter order for an investigation u/s 156(3) Cr.P.C...........

Civil Procedure Code, 1908, Order 6, Rule 17 -- Amendment of plaint - At appellate stage - Amendment sought would have the effect of changing very nature of case - Court committed no fault in rejecting application for amendment - No interference warranted in impugned order...........
